Subject: JV with Marrowfield — quick heads-up

Hi all,

Finance has finished the first pass on the proposed joint venture with Marrowfield Logistics. The numbers look workable: shared capex on the Dunloe hub, split roughly 60/40, with breakeven projected inside three years. Teya's team flagged a few tax wrinkles we'll cover Thursday. Before that meeting, please review the confidential note on our business plans below.

board note of bawep-tajef: Queniusek Systems plans to raise the Quenvan list price by 53.1 percent in March. The pricing group signed off on a budget of $176.4 million for Project Drueth. The renewal with Casionix Partners closes at $142.5 million a year, 8.3 percent below the last contract. Project Fraax slips by six weeks because of the tooling delay.

## Runbook: Taming Chatterbox's logs

So, Chatterbox still logs like it's paid per line. We've rolled out adaptive sampling to keep the aggregator from melting during traffic spikes — debug lines get sampled hard, warnings lightly, errors never. If the sync asks why dashboards look sparser, that's why; counts are extrapolated from sample rates. To adjust, edit the sampling config and restart the sidecar, not the main process. Current sampling values are below.

settings of fafog-haduf:
ZORIX_PIN=4648
ZORIX_METRICS_HOST=metrics.zorix.paliqsys.corp
ZORIX_LOG_LEVEL=info
ZORIX_TENANT=druix

## Rolling out FlagForge v3

Heads up, future maintainers: FlagForge rollouts go in three waves — canary, the Pindle cluster, then everything else. Don't skip the canary soak; we learned that the hard way during the Q2 Lanternfish incident. Bump the manifest version, run `forge bundle`, and sanity-check the percentage gates in the staging console before promoting. Once the bundle is built, it needs signing before the deploy daemon will accept it. Sign with the key below.

rollout seal: bky4_x7Gc